Dr Iain McGilchrist is a Psychiatrist and philosopher provides some insight into the application of left and right brain dominant functions. At a recent training I attended he described the recent growth in the global economy (post industrial revolution was as a result of left brain dominant processes and the economic growth of the future will be as a result of right brain dominant processes. These are the creative and dominant processes that are stimulated during moments of deep reflection engaging these creative and innovative processes that come to the fore when we are not in task orientation having a shower, walking, swimming, running, relaxing etc. He refers to this state as “the gift”
